Skip to content

Instantly share code, notes, and snippets.

View xqft's full-sized avatar
💭
zk

Estéfano Bargas xqft

💭
zk
  • LambdaClass
  • Uruguay
View GitHub Profile
@xqft
xqft / Dockerfile
Last active January 16, 2023 19:51
Simple api in flask w/docker
FROM python:3.9-slim AS base
ENV PYTHONDONTWRITEBYTECODE 1
ENV PYTHONFAULTHANDLER 1
FROM base AS builder
COPY Pipfile Pipfile.lock ./
RUN python -m pip install --upgrade pip
@xqft
xqft / index.html
Created October 10, 2022 13:24
Grupal 5
<!DOCTYPE html>
<html lang="es">
<head>
<meta charset="UTF-8" />
<meta http-equiv="X-UA-Compatible" content="IE=edge" />
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
<link
href="https://cdn.jsdelivr.net/npm/bootstrap@5.0.2/dist/css/bootstrap.min.css"
rel="stylesheet"
integrity="sha384-EVSTQN3/azprG1Anm3QDgpJLIm9Nao0Yz1ztcQTwFspd3yD65VohhpuuCOmLASjC"
@xqft
xqft / index.html
Last active September 29, 2022 16:03
Grupal 4 final
<!doctype html>
<html lang="es">
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1">
<title>Japflix</title>
>
<link href="css/bootstrap.min.css" rel="stylesheet">
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7.0/css/font-awesome.min.css">
@xqft
xqft / script.js
Created September 28, 2022 22:41
Grupal 4
const MOVIES_URL = "https://japceibal.github.io/japflix_api/movies-data.json";
async function getData() {
const response = await fetch(MOVIES_URL);
return response.json();
}
const datos = getData();
document.addEventListener("DOMContentLoaded", async () => {
const input = document.querySelector("#inputBuscar");
@xqft
xqft / prime.js
Created September 15, 2022 00:02
Funcion isPrime()
const limite = 20000;
function isPrime(num) {
let prime = true;
for (let i = 2; i < (num/2 + 1); i++)
if (num % i === 0) {
prime = false;
break;
}
@xqft
xqft / index.html
Last active September 14, 2022 22:25
Avance de entrega grupal 3
<!doctype html>
<html lang="es">
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1">
<title>Buscador de imágenes de la NASA</title>
<link href="css/bootstrap.min.css" rel="stylesheet">
<link rel="stylesheet" href="css/style.css">
@xqft
xqft / almacenar.js
Last active September 5, 2022 23:46
Trabajo grupal JaP 31/8, lista de tareas
document.addEventListener('DOMContentLoaded', () => {
const btnAgregar = document.querySelector('#agregar');
const lista = document.querySelector('#contenedor');
const titulo = document.querySelector('#titulo');
const grupoTitulo = document.querySelector('.needs-validation');
const descripcion = document.querySelector('#descripcion');
let listado = window.localStorage.getItem('lista');
listado = JSON.parse(listado)
@xqft
xqft / almacenar.js
Last active August 31, 2022 21:21
Trabajo en clase sobre Entrega 2, JaP, 24/08
document.addEventListener('DOMContentLoaded', () => {
const input = document.querySelector('#item');
const btnAgregar = document.querySelector('#agregar');
const btnTitulo = document.querySelector('#titulo');
const btnSeparador = document.querySelector('#separador');
const btnLimpiar = document.querySelector('#limpiar');
const lista = document.querySelector('#contenedor');
let listado = window.localStorage.getItem('lista');
listado = JSON.parse(listado)
window.addEventListener('DOMContentLoaded', () => {
const container = document.querySelector(".board");
for(let i = 0; i <= 63; i++) {
const cell = document.createElement("div");
const index = Math.floor(i + i/8); // numero de celda + numero de fila
cell.classList.add(isEven(index) ? "white" : "black");
container.append(cell);
}
@xqft
xqft / main.js
Last active July 28, 2022 00:29
window.addEventListener('DOMContentLoaded', () => {
const container = document.querySelector(".board");
for(let i = 0; i <= 63; i++) {
const cell = document.createElement("div");
const index = Math.floor(i + i/8); // numero de celda + numero de fila
cell.classList.add(isEven(index) ? "white" : "black");
container.append(cell);
}